Yeah so I bought a weapons lot and when I got it I noticed something. The part of stock that connects to megatron, has a lever that operates a spring inside that fires a missle. Anyone know anything about this??????????????

The Stock, and silencer bits combine to form a battle station which in the original Microman version had a spring loaded mechanism to fire pellets. It was removed in subsequent versions of the figure including the G1 toy.

Some of the special editions of the figure have reincorporated the mechanism.

The Third Party add-on set for MP Megatron features a similar mechanism.

The toy that Megatron was made out of (The Microchange Gun Robo P38) featured two firing gimmicks, one inside the gun itself and one in the stock for when you converted the stock to it's gun battery mode. For Hasbro's release of it, the gimmick had been removed, but I do believe that in all Japanese releases the gimmick was intact. It was never a particularly strong launcher, as I can only get my TF Collection Megatron to shoot his little pellets a foot or two before they drop to the ground, but still a cool gimmick to have.
